The female members of Dundalk Cuchulainn Cycling Club's Women’s Lap of Louth which will take place this Sunday 18th August 2024.
Now in its fourth year, this annual “female only” cycle, is a renowned all Ireland wide cycling event attracts girls and women cyclists from all 32 counties.
Last Year the Cuchulainn Club was greatly saddened to lose one of its stalwart members Sarah Fagan who tragically drowned whilst participating in the Alpe d’ Huez Triathlon in France.
“Sarah was an esteemed member of the Cuchulainn club for many years, always a keen athlete eager to take on a challenge but especially remembered as someone who was forever on hand to encourage others, especially women and girls to join in the sports she loved” , a Sarah Fagan Women's Lap of Louth spokesperson said.
Last Year the Women's Lap of Louth was renamed the Sarah Fagan Womens Lap of Louth in memory of Sarah and the tremendous impact she had on women in sport.
As in previous years, the Women's Lap of Louth will link into Sport Ireland’s “HER Outdoors Week” initiative which is designed to attract more women into sport and to encourage women to enjoy the social and health benefits sporting activities provide.
Cuchullainn CC and the Women's Lap of Louth said they are committed to inclusivity and is also proud to support and encourage our chosen charity partner, Louth Disability Cycling Club.
The cycle offers two routes, 50Km and 90km both of which sweep their way across the rolling green hills of Louth, the picturesque villages dotted throughout the county and the beautiful coastal road with spectacular views across to the Mourne Mountains.

The all-important date to mark in your diary is Sunday 18th August 2024, when the Sarah Fagan Women’s Lap of Louth pedals off from DkIT Sports Centre at 10.00am.
Registration is now open online and participants may register on the day between 08.30-09.30 with roll out from the Start Line at 10.00am.
Registration Fee is €20 online and €25 on the day.
